
拓海先生、お時間いただきありがとうございます。最近、部下から「概念ドリフトが問題だ」と聞かされまして、正直ピンと来ないのですが、うちの現場で何を直せば良いのか知りたいのです。

素晴らしい着眼点ですね!概念ドリフトは、データの性質が時間で変わる現象で、モデルが古い前提のままだと性能劣化する問題です。今日は「交互学習器(Alternating Learners)」という考え方を、経営判断に役立つ観点から分かりやすく説明しますよ。

なるほど。しかし、現場では毎日大量のデータが入ってきます。投資対効果の観点で、我々がやるべき優先順位は何になるのでしょうか。

大丈夫、一緒に整理しましょう。要点は三つです。まず、モデルがいつ更新すべきかを見極める仕組みが必要です。次に、軽く試せる短期学習器を用意して迅速に適応できること。そして、変更が本当に必要かを判断するための比較指標を設けることです。

これって要するに、常駐の“大きなモデル”と、状況を素早く学ぶ“小さなモデル”を並べておき、性能差でどちらを使うか切り替えるということですか?

その通りですよ。正しく理解されています。具体的には、長期記憶のモデル(Long-memory learner)は過去の安定した傾向を保持し、短期記憶のモデル(Short-memory learner)は直近の変化に素早く追従します。そして常に両者を新しいデータで評価して、どちらがより信頼できるかで出力を決めるのです。

運用コストが気になります。長期モデルは学習コストが高いと聞きますが、その負担をどう抑えれば良いですか。クラウドも苦手でして。

安心してください。ポイントは三つだけです。第一に、長期モデルは頻繁に再学習しないこと。安定期はそのまま使うだけで良いです。第二に、短期モデルは軽量にしてローカルやエッジで動かせばコストが低いです。第三に、切り替え判定を閾値で厳格にすると無駄な更新を避けられます。

なるほど。実務ではどのくらいの頻度で短期モデルをチェックすれば良いのでしょうか。現場の作業サイクルと合わせたいのです。

運用周期は業務ごとに最適化します。経験則としては、データが日単位で変わる現場なら日次バッチで、分単位で変わる現場なら短周期での評価が必要です。ここでも要点は三つ、現場サイクルに合わせる、閾値で発動を抑える、最初は保守的に設定して徐々に緩めることです。

わかりました。では最後に私の理解を確認させてください。要するに、まずは小さく短期対応できる仕組みを作り、長期モデルは重要な節目だけ更新する。評価で短期が良ければ切り替えるという運用で、無駄な投資を防げるということで間違いないでしょうか。

その通りです!素晴らしい総括ですね。実行の順序は、まず短期学習器の導入で効果を試し、次に閾値と更新スケジュールを決め、最後に長期モデルの更新方針を定めればスムーズです。大丈夫、一緒にやれば必ずできますよ。

よく理解できました。まずは短期モデルを試して、一定期間内で改善が見られるかを評価し、問題なければ既存の長期モデルは据え置くという方針で進めます。ありがとうございました。
1. 概要と位置づけ
結論から言うと、本研究は「時間で変わるデータ分布(概念ドリフト)に対して、低コストでかつ実務的に運用可能な適応戦略」を示した点で重要である。
具体的には、過去の長期的な傾向を保持する学習器(Long-memory learner)と、直近の変化に素早く適応する学習器(Short-memory learner)を並列に運用し、最新データで双方を比較して出力を切り替えるというシンプルなアイデアに基づく。
この設計は、モデル更新の頻度とコストを実務的な観点から折り合わせることを意図している。長期的に安定した概念では大規模モデルを活かし、変化が起きた局面では短期モデルへ素早くフォールバックする運用を可能にする。
経営層にとって重要なのは、これは「どのタイミングで、本当に再投資すべきか」を判断するための運用ルールを提供する点である。単なる精度向上のための研究ではなく、現場運用に直結する判断基準を提示している。
そのため、本研究は予測システムの投資対効果を高めつつ、現場負担を抑える実務指向の提案である。
2. 先行研究との差別化ポイント
過去の研究は概念ドリフトへの対処法として、継続的再学習や多数のモデルを用いた複雑なアンサンブルを提案してきたが、いずれも計算コストや運用負荷が高い点が実務導入の障壁であった。
本研究の差別化は、シンプルさと運用性にある。長期と短期という二つの記憶ウィンドウを明確に分離し、入ってきたバッチごとに二者の性能差を検出するルールベースの切り替え方を示した。
技術面では、複雑なメタ学習や重み付け最適化を行わず、閾値や最小リセット間隔などの少数のハイパーパラメータで制御可能にしている点が特徴だ。これにより運用設計や説明が容易となる。
ビジネス的には、頻繁にモデルを作り直すコストを削減しつつ、変化に応じた柔軟な対応ができる運用を両立している点が既存手法との差し詰めた利点である。
総じて、本研究は“実用性重視の折衷案”として先行研究群の空白を埋める位置づけにある。
3. 中核となる技術的要素
中核は二つの学習器とその交互運用ルールである。長期学習器(Long-memory learner)は広いウィンドウのデータで訓練され、安定した関係を学ぶ役割を担う。短期学習器(Short-memory learner)は最新データに基づき迅速に再学習し、変化に対する感度を高める。
交互運用のポリシーはシンプルである。新しいバッチが到着した際に両者の予測誤差を計測し、長期が閾値以下であれば長期を採用、そうでなければ短期を採用するというルールだ。これにより、変化が生じた局面で短期が優れるなら自動的に切り替えられる。
さらに、長期学習器には複数の候補(複雑モデルと単純モデル)を用意し、過学習リスクやデータ量不足時に対応できる工夫がある。運用上は性能追跡用のキューや最小リセット間隔で安定性を担保する。
技術的要素を一言で言えば、「軽量で説明可能な判定ロジックにより、長期の安定性と短期の機敏性を両立させる」ことである。
この設計は実装難易度を抑え、既存の予測パイプラインへの組み込みを容易にしている。
4. 有効性の検証方法と成果
有効性の検証は合成データと実データ上で行われ、概念ドリフト発生時の追従性と安定期の性能維持の両面が評価された。比較対象には単一モデルの継続運用や多数モデルアンサンブルが含まれる。
実験結果は、変化が発生した局面で短期学習器の優位性が顕在化し、AL(Alternating Learners)方式は迅速に性能を回復させたことを示している。一方で、変化がない局面では長期学習器を維持することで不要な更新を避けられた。
また、計算コストの観点でも、頻繁に大規模モデルを再訓練する方式に比べて総コストを抑えられるという実務的な利点が示された。特にエッジやオンプレミス環境での適用性が高い。
この成果は、投資対効果を意識する経営判断に直結するものであり、まずは短期学習器で試験運用を行い、その結果に基づいて段階的拡張を検討する運用が現実的であることを示した。
検証は網羅的ではないが、現場導入を念頭に置いた実験設計であり、次段階のPoC(Proof of Concept)へ移行しやすい結果と言える。
5. 研究を巡る議論と課題
本手法の議論点は主に三つある。第一に、短期学習器が誤検出した場合の誤った切り替えによる一時的な性能低下である。第二に、概念ドリフトの種類(急峻な変化か緩やかな変化か)により最適なウィンドウ長や閾値が変わる点である。第三に、運用設計での監査性と説明性の確保が求められる点だ。
対策として、誤検出の影響を緩和するために最小リセット間隔や性能トラッキングキューが設けられているが、実務ではさらに人間によるモニタリングやエスカレーションルールを追加することが望ましい。
また、ウィンドウ長や閾値は業務ドメインに依存するため、導入時のチューニングと継続的な評価が不可欠である。これを自動化する研究も並行して進める必要がある。
最後に、法規制や品質管理の観点から、モデル切り替えのログや説明可能性を確保する実装指針が求められる。これにより、経営判断と監査要件の両立が可能となる。
要するに、手法自体は実用的だが、導入時の運用ルール設計と継続的な改善プロセスが成功の鍵である。
6. 今後の調査・学習の方向性
今後の研究課題は、モデル切り替えポリシーの自動最適化、概念ドリフトのタイプ分類、そして監査可能な切り替え記録のためのログ設計である。これらは現場導入をスケールさせるために必要な要素だ。
特にポリシーの自動化は、閾値の動的調整やメタ学習を用いた最適化が考えられるが、ここでの注意点は運用の説明性を損なわないことである。経営層が意思決定に使える形で出力される必要がある。
また、業界別のベンチマークを蓄積して、どの程度の変化が経済的に再学習を正当化するかという判断基準を整備することが望ましい。これにより投資判断が定量化できる。
最後に、実践的な次の一手としては、まずは限定的なラインや工程で短期学習器を導入し、効果と運用コストを実データで測ることを推奨する。小さく始めて結果に応じて拡大するのが現場に合う。
以上の方向性に従えば、本手法は現場での意思決定と投資効率を高める実務的な技術基盤となる。
検索に使える英語キーワード
会議で使えるフレーズ集
- 「まずは短期学習器で現場効果を検証しましょう」
- 「長期モデルは安定期に据え置き、変化時のみ切り替えます」
- 「閾値と最小リセット間隔で無駄な再学習を防ぎます」
- 「まずは限定ラインでPoCを行い、効果を定量化しましょう」
- 「切り替えログは監査向けに必須です」


